About this course

Environment and sustainability is a field that addresses the most pressing questions of our time: how human activity is altering natural systems, what the consequences of those alterations are, and how we can manage our relationship with the natural world more wisely and equitably. It draws on ecology, earth science, geography, economics, and social science to examine environmental change across scales from local ecosystems to global climate systems, and to evaluate the policies, technologies, and behaviours that can move us towards more sustainable ways of living. At Birkbeck College, which has a long tradition of accessible higher education and a teaching team of internationally recognised researchers, this four-year programme includes a foundation year to support students who need a structured entry point into degree-level scientific study. You will develop a deep understanding of what drives environmental change, including the physical and biological processes involved, and how natural systems can be managed under unprecedented pressure. The programme combines theoretical understanding with substantial practical experience, developing skills in data collection, analysis, geographical information systems, and environmental assessment that are valued across environmental professions. Graduates from environment and sustainability programmes work in environmental consultancy, local and national government, conservation organisations, environmental agencies, international development, sustainability management in business, and the growing green economy sector. Roles in environmental impact assessment, sustainability reporting, ecological monitoring, and policy analysis are all common career destinations. The urgency of the environmental challenges facing the world means demand for graduates with this knowledge is growing. Many graduates also pursue postgraduate study in environmental science, sustainability, ecology, or policy, developing specialist expertise for research or professional leadership in the field.
